摘要
螺杆转子是螺杆泵的核心部件,综合使用Pro/E软件和ANSYS软件建立螺杆转子有限元分析模型,根据有限元思想将连续变化的螺旋面压力离散处理,利用ANSYS软件中的APDL语言模块,编程实现离散面的加载,计算分析了螺杆转子的动态特征和动响应,为螺杆转子设计提供了依据。
The screw rotor is the key of the screw pump. The 3-D model of the screw is made by using the Pro/E and ANSYS. By using the finite element method, the continued screw area can be divided into scattered small areas to load pressure on area easily. The APDL module of ANSYS is used to write APDL program to fuifill the load steps. The dynamic character and transient dynamic of the screw rotor is calculated ,which provides the bases for designing the screw rotor.
